This sequel to "Hawaii" continues James A. Michener's epic island saga into the 20th century with the story of sea captain Whip Hoxworth (Charlton Heston, playing the grandson of the Richard Harris character from the first film) and his relationship with a stowaway (Tina Chen) he discovers aboard his boat. Hoxworth provides for his family as a pineapple farmer, but his wife (Geraldine Chaplin) is stricken by madness after giving birth. With Mako, John Phillip Law. 134 min.
